Falcon Studios Content Now Available Through Roku

Falcon Studios Content Now Available Through Roku

SAN FRANCISCO — Falcon Studios and affiliate network BuddyProfits have announced the availability of content via Roku from FalconStudios.com, RagingStallion.com and newly launched mega-site FistingInferno.com.

"Members and fans simply need to locate each site's corresponding channel on Roku and activate it to access the content through their television," a rep explained. "The launch of the sites with channels on Roku add another benefit to members who have recently seen numerous enhancements to their subscriptions. One of Roku’s best-kept secrets is the capability to add porn channels quickly and easily."

"After activation, members will be able to enjoy full access to stream any of the thousands of scenes available on the sites in full definition," noted the rep.

"Adding Falcon, Raging Stallion and Fisting Inferno to Roku is a big step in giving our subscribers an even more immersive experience with our award-winning quality content in the highest definition we have available,” Falcon/NakedSword President Tim Valenti said.
